Day 4: Fly from Pokhara to Jomsom (2,720 m)
In the morning we will take an early flight to Jomsom which will offer remarkable views of Mountains. From here onwards it is very windy in the afternoon. The path is quite barren with rocks and sands and the path is mostly flat. This trial will offer picturesque view of peaks like Dhaulagiri, Nilgiri, Tukuche Peak and Dhampus .
Day 5: Trek to Kagbeni (2,900 m)
Next morning, we will towards Kagbeni after freshen up and having our breakfast. Kagbeni is the last village and the entrance point of Lower Mustang, which is situated at the top cliff. Along the trek, you will be visiting the King’s palace of 100 rooms, 800-year-old brick red Shakya Gompa, Kali Gandaki, and the Jhong Khola rivers, and so forth. Also, on the way, you will view Dhaulagiri, Tukuche, and Nilgiri, and, to the south, the Annapurna Massif.
Day 6: Trek to Muktinath (3710 m) with visit to Red Gompa.
After breakfast in Kagbeni, start your second day of the trek. You’ll first reach a village called Khingar and then Jharkot, which are both good places to stop for tea or lunch. Continue trekking until you get to another village called Ranipauwa and then continue to a small village surrounded by green hills called Muktinath.
Day 7: Trek to Marpha via Lupra Valley (2,790)
After breakfast at your teahouse, pay a visit to Muktinath Temple, an important place of worship for Nepalese Buddhists and Hindus. You will have the opportunity to visit the main temple and its surrounding area before you hit the trail. one hours more trek from Jomsom you will reach Marpha village.
